What is subject-verb agreement?

Back

Subject-verb agreement means that the subject of a sentence and the verb must match in number. If the subject is singular, the verb must be singular; if the subject is plural, the verb must be plural.

When do we use 'is'?

Back

We use 'is' with singular subjects, such as 'The cat is sleeping.'

When do we use 'are'?

Back

We use 'are' with plural subjects, such as 'The dogs are barking.'

What is a singular subject?

Back

A singular subject refers to one person, place, thing, or idea, like 'The girl' or 'The car.'

What is a plural subject?

Back

A plural subject refers to more than one person, place, thing, or idea, like 'The girls' or 'The cars.'
